Zimbabwe National Cricket Team vs Ireland National Cricket Team Match Scorecard Live Streaming Details: Zimbabwe will take on Ireland in a pivotal Group B match of the ICC T20 World Cup 2026 at the Pallekele International Cricket Stadium on Tuesday, February 17, 2026. Zimbabwe, currently second in the group with two wins from as many games, can secure a spot in the next round with a victory over Ireland. The team has already defeated Oman and Australia, and a win against Ireland could leave Australia facing an early exit from the tournament for the first time since 2009. Ireland, level on points with Australia but behind on net run rate, will aim to upset Zimbabwe after a win over Oman to keep their own Super 8 hopes alive. The live telecast of the match is available on the Star Sports Network. Fans can also stream the match live on the JioHotstar app and website.
